Course Details
• Unit 1: Introduction to Inclusive Arts: Understanding the concept and importance of inclusive arts in today's society. • Unit 2: Disability Awareness: Exploring different types of disabilities and how to create inclusive arts programs for people with disabilities. • Unit 3: Cultural Diversity in Arts: Examining the role of culture in arts and how to create inclusive arts programs that cater to diverse cultural backgrounds. • Unit 4: Strategies for Inclusive Arts Programming: Learning best practices for developing and implementing inclusive arts programs. • Unit 5: Universal Design in Arts Education: Understanding the principles of universal design and how to apply them to arts education. • Unit 6: Accessible Communication in Arts: Exploring different communication methods and techniques to ensure accessibility in arts programs. • Unit 7: Inclusive Arts and Technology: Examining the role of technology in inclusive arts and how it can be used to enhance accessibility. • Unit 8: Collaboration and Partnership in Inclusive Arts: Learning how to build successful partnerships and collaborations to create inclusive arts programs. • Unit 9: Evaluation and Assessment in Inclusive Arts: Understanding the importance of evaluation and assessment in inclusive arts programs and how to measure their success. • Unit 10: Advocacy and Policy in Inclusive Arts: Exploring the role of advocacy and policy in promoting inclusive arts and how to influence change in arts institutions.
